    Instrumental, Easy listening, 1 min 34 s. The Free Music Archive ( FMA) is an online repository of royalty-free music. Established in 2009 by the East Orange, New Jersey community radio station WFMU and in cooperation with fellow stations KBOO and KEXP, it aims to provide music under Creative Commons licenses that can be freely downloaded and ...

    Gwen Renée Stefani was born on October 3, 1969, in Fullerton, California, [18] and raised Catholic in nearby Anaheim. [19] She was named after a stewardess in the 1968 novel Airport, and her middle name, Renée, comes from the Four Tops' 1968 version of the Left Banke's 1966 song "Walk Away Renée". [20]

    Right Place Right Time (song) " Right Place Right Time " is a song by English singer-songwriter Olly Murs. It was released in the United Kingdom on 25 August 2013 as the fourth single from his album of the same name. [1] The song was written by Murs, Claude Kelly, Steve Robson and produced by Robson. The track reached No. 27 in the UK Top 40.
